Walking into The Philadelphian at 2320 Tamiami Trl, Port Charlotte, FL 33952, United States feels like stepping into a familiar neighborhood hangout where everyone knows what good comfort food is supposed to taste like. I stopped by on a busy weekday afternoon, the kind of time when a diner either proves its consistency or falls apart. Instead, the room buzzed with easy conversation, servers moved with purpose, and the smell of grilled steak and onions set the tone before I even glanced at the menu.

The menu leans hard into classic Philly-style favorites, and that focus shows confidence. Cheesesteaks dominate, built on soft rolls with thin-sliced beef, melted cheese, and toppings that don’t overwhelm the core flavors. Having spent time in Pennsylvania and sampled plenty of regional versions, I can say the method here respects tradition: hot flat-top grill, quick cook, and constant motion so nothing dries out. That technique matters. According to culinary research published by the Institute of Culinary Education, rapid high-heat cooking preserves moisture and flavor in thin-cut meats, which explains why these sandwiches stay juicy even during rush hours.

Beyond cheesesteaks, there’s a solid lineup of burgers, breakfast plates, and homestyle sides. On one visit, I watched a short-order cook handle three different orders at once, cracking eggs, flipping patties, and calling out plates with practiced rhythm. That kind of efficiency doesn’t happen overnight; it’s the result of repetition and clear kitchen systems. The National Restaurant Association often notes that consistency in process is one of the biggest drivers of repeat customers, and the steady stream of regulars here backs that up.

Reviews from locals tend to highlight portion size and value, and that matches my experience. Plates arrive full, sometimes bordering on excessive, which suits the diner vibe perfectly. Prices stay reasonable, especially compared to chain restaurants nearby, and you leave feeling like you got more than you paid for. From a practical standpoint, that balance between cost and quantity is why diners like this survive when trends change around them.

Service plays a big role too. On my visits, staff members remembered returning guests and checked in without hovering. That personal touch builds trust. In hospitality studies from Cornell University’s School of Hotel Administration, customer satisfaction scores rise significantly when guests feel recognized rather than rushed, even in casual dining settings. You can sense that philosophy at work here, even if it’s never spelled out.

The location along Tamiami Trail makes it easy to reach whether you’re local or just passing through Port Charlotte. Parking is straightforward, and the dining room layout keeps things comfortable without feeling cramped. One limitation worth noting is that peak times can mean a short wait, especially on weekends, but turnover is quick and the kitchen keeps orders moving.

What stands out most is how everything connects: the focused menu, the practiced cooking methods, the friendly service, and the steady positive reviews all reinforce each other. It’s not trying to reinvent diner food or chase food trends. Instead, it sticks to what works, executes it well, and earns loyalty through reliability. That kind of straightforward approach is harder to pull off than it looks, and it’s why so many people keep coming back for another sandwich, another breakfast plate, and another casual meal that feels just right.

  • 12 years living around here and I didnt know a place like this existed until I google searched cheese steaks near me because i was craving it bad but I didnt think anything was going to come up. I saw this listing and immediately hopped on my motorcycle for my first visit. I ordered the Cheese Steak Bomb and it was fantastic. Its hard to get authentic cheese steaks like that anywhere around here. I was met with a young gentlemen who took my order amd prepared it for me really fast and served it to me at my table. The cheese steak was piping hot and its all cooked in front of you. The place is small and charming and felt like an authentic family run business. There were no other customers when i got there intitially, but when i was done eating there was a line out the door. When you are craving a cheese steak, its serious....and this place satisfies, and leaves you wanting more...bringing the whole family next time!

  • Having lived in Philadelphia for almost half of my life, it was nice to see a local business with my favorite Philadelphia food staple. I think they are as close as you can get to the Philadelphian cheesesteaks that i used to eat when i lived there even with the amoroso bread to top it off. We also love their cheese curds with the cheese sauce on the side. We would definitely come back one day soon.
